Document #1060 Program #10 (5 numbers at the end) Note: Management Access Security will be needed for all of the procedures in this document. To place the call accounting in Management Access mode press the MANAGEMENT ACCESS Key followed by the code number) A Program #10 reports information about your system and permits you to view the programmable parameters for Programs 1 throught 9 as they are currently set. Please refer to your manual for step by step instructions to re-programs, programs 1 through 9. To print a program #10 Press the MGMT. ACCESS key, Press the numbers that are the management access code for your system, Press ENTER Press the PROGRAM key Press 10 Press ENTER Program #10 will print. WHAT DO THE FIVE NUMBERS AT THE BOTTOM OF PROGRAM 10 REPRESENT Reading from left to right; Times the system has been reset..........0 Buffer overflow..........................0 Incoming calls...........................0 The number of re-initialization that have occurred other than manual.....0 The number of calls in the buffer........0 These numbers will change and be different on every system. They are not programmable and are only used when trouble shooting the system.
